It turns out there is a deeply profound and culturally important reason why Japan produces some of the best home products in the world. It all stems from the Japanese dedication to craftsmanship (monozukuri), hospitality (omotenashi), and a general goal to perfect everything they do. This culturally embedded mindset keeps Japan at the forefront of creativity when it comes to producing goods. Zojirushi 10-cup Coffee Maker

The Thermal Carafe Coffee Maker is a highly reviewed product from the minds of Zojirushi. This Japanese brand is over 100 years old. And that craftsmanship legacy is present in this sleek coffee maker. It can prepare 10 cups of hot coffee or four iced coffees' worth of espresso-like brew. One of the most unique aspects of this machine is its automatic pre-blooming feature. It wets the coffee to allow the grounds to breathe for a bit before they're ultimately brewed. Pieria Folding Washing Machine

The Pieria Folding Washing Machine is a Japanese solution to small loads of laundry or laundry on the go. Folded out, this little machine is 11 inches by 11 inches by 10 inches. It folds down to 11 inches by 11 inches by 4 inches. It comes in soft pink, green, and white. Sharp HEALSIO Steam Ovens

Just this year, Japanese company Sharp released a new AI-integrated line of Healsio steam ovens. These superheated steam ovens come in four different models. Each iteration features AI and smartphone connectivity through "CookTalk" AI. This allows the user to generate recipes with ingredients they already have available. IRIS Futon Portable Blanket Dryer and Heater

Japan is hot and humid in the summer. Unfortunately, this weather leaves homes vulnerable to house mites. The best way to combat these pests is to air out futons and bedding. You'll often see linens outside in Japan for this reason. However, this isn't exactly possible during the monsoon season. Enter the IRIS Futon Portable Blanket Dryer and Heater. This handy invention easily airs out bedding. Super Suction Futon Cleaner

Another unique, mite-fighting invention out of Japan is the Super Suction Futon Cleaner and Mite Sensor. This lightweight device not only sucks up dust and allergens, but it also uses a lamp to show the user how many mites are present. Even if you don't have a heavy mite presence in your home, mattresses tend to get pretty grimy over time. Think of them like a sponge absorbing years' worth of sweat, dead skin cells, mildew, and bacteria. This device makes short work of a dingy mattress, helping you put more years on it.
